WebThe Power Lift: use of body mechanics. With the back straight, feet apart and abs tensed, lifting is done from the waist down. A firm "power grip" is used. The Power Grip: palms and fingers come in complete contact with the object (gripping, not hooking). The Squat Lift: same as power lift but with one foot (the weaker foot) slightly forward.
